**Q: Why does CI reject my unpinned dependency?**

Short version: on Brackenlight, every direct dependency gets an exact pin, and the lockfile is the source of truth. Ranges caused two bad Friday deploys, so we stopped. Bot-driven bumps land weekly. The full policy, exceptions process, and bump schedule are written up here.

wiki page, bagaf-fawip: https://harbor.tolvaqsys.local/pages/repo/pages/secrets/eac969ffc71f356b

### Migration Guide — Step 4: Enable shard routing for the Orvella profile store

Before cutting traffic over, verify that every application node has the shard map loaded and that the router agrees on the hash ring version. Do not proceed if any node reports a stale ring; mismatched routing during the window will write profiles to the wrong shard and complicate rollback. Once verification passes, apply the settings below to the router tier. The required configuration values are as follows.

service settings:
druael:
  log_level: error
  metrics_host: metrics.druael.tolvaqlabs.internal
  pool_size: 16

Subject: Reconciliation job — status for Wednesday sync

Team,

The Stockline reconciliation job for the Verdane warehouse feed is green again. Root cause of last week's drift: duplicate delta files from the upstream exporter. Dedupe filter shipped Monday; counts now match ledger within tolerance. Overnight run completed in 41 minutes, down from 2+ hours. No manual corrections outstanding. Next step is enabling the hourly incremental mode behind a flag — decision at sync. The validated run is referenced by the token below.

— Tomas

session token of bawep-yadup = htk21_528abd376e3c5a4ec24a1

RUNBOOK — Thumbforge queue. If thumbnails stall, check the worker count first (usually someone scaled it to zero, honestly). Restart with `forgectl restart thumbs`. Backlog over 10k? Bump workers to 8 and let it drain. The workers also need the queue broker credential before they'll connect — new machines won't have it. Put this line in the worker's env file:

env line for fafof-fahag: LEDGER_TOKEN5=f8790

Blue-green cutover for the Quillbatch billing worker: drain the blue pool, verify green has processed at least one settlement cycle, then update the router alias. Never flip mid-cycle. The deploy manifest must be countersigned before the alias change, and the countersignature is generated with the key that follows.

deploy key for kafof-kaguf: bky9_WnPyu8S2E